Each of the questions or incomplete statements below is followed by five suggested answers or completions. Select the one that is best in each case. What kind of psychologist would be most likely to use a projective personality assessment? (A) social cognitive (B) trait (C) behaviorist (D) humanistic (E) psychoanalytic

Step 1: Projective personality assessments involve open-ended questions or tasks where the individual's responses are believed to reveal underlying unconscious thoughts and feelings. Show more…
